Oxygen and Transfusion Strategies in Trauma Care
This chapter explores a recent study on oxygen administration strategies for trauma patients, highlighting the findings of the Traumox2 Randomised Clinical Trial. It compares restrictive versus liberal oxygen strategies, revealing no significant differences in major outcomes, while also addressing transfusion strategies in critically ill patients with traumatic brain injury. The discussion emphasizes the implications of these findings for clinical practice and the need for more robust trials in trauma care.
